Description

Get the official AQA GCSE Physics Paper 2 Higher Tier mark scheme for the June 2025 exam series (8463/2H). This final v1.0 examiner-approved PDF contains the exact accepted answers, alternative responses, graph tolerances, calculation methods, level-of-response guidance, and examiner instructions used during live marking of the 2025 GCSE Physics examinations.

This Physics 2H mark scheme covers visible light and sound waves, wave-speed equations, Hooke’s law, spring-extension investigations, uncertainty calculations, random-error analysis, acceleration from gradient graphs, converging lenses and ray diagrams, electromagnetic radiation and red shift, satellite velocity, terminal velocity, atmospheric pressure, vector-diagram calculations, braking-force equations, momentum and deceleration, motor effect and Fleming’s left-hand rule, magnetic flux density calculations, electric motors, liquid pressure and upthrust, density and floating objects, transformers, electromagnetic induction, and alternating current across the AQA GCSE Physics specification. It includes official examiner guidance for six-mark explanation questions, graph interpretation, vector-diagram construction, equation-sheet application, practical-method evaluation, multi-step calculations, and accepted physics terminology exactly as applied by AQA examiners.
